B&R X20AT4222 RTD Temperature Input Module

Technical Specifications
Model:X20AT4222
Brand:B&R
Product Type:X20 system 4‑channel RTD temperature measurement input module
Applicable System:B&R X20 PLC system,applied for packaging machinery,process automation equipment for multi‑point thermal resistance temperature signal acquisition
Channel Quantity:4 independent RTD input channels
Supported Sensor:PT100,PT1000(EN60751)
Temperature Range:‑200℃ ~ +850℃
Resolution:16‑bit,0.1K
Wiring Mode:software configurable 2‑wire /3‑wire
Measurement Current:250µA ±1.25%
Resistance Measuring Range:0.1‑4500Ω
Filter:1st‑order low‑pass filter,filter time 1ms‑66.7ms configurable
Isolation:500Veff between sensor side and system bus
Diagnosis:sensor open‑circuit detection,channel‑wise LED status indicator
Power Consumption:bus 0.01W,internal I/O 1.1W
Installation:Install on X20 backplane,matching X20BM11 bus module and X20TB12 terminal block
Indicator:per‑channel diagnostic LED for status and fault alarm
Degree of protection:IP20
Certification:CE,cUL‑us,ATEX Zone2,UKCA,DNV,CCS,LR,ABS,BV marine certification
Working temperature:‑20℃ ~ +65℃
Storage temperature:‑40℃ ~ +85℃
Relative humidity:5‑95% non‑condensing,pollution degree 2
Built‑in function:X20 series multi‑channel RTD temperature input module collects PT100 / PT1000 thermal resistance temperature signals. Each channel supports independent sensor parameter configuration. Software selects 2‑wire or 3‑wire wiring mode. Built‑in sensor open‑circuit fault diagnosis function. LED indicators support fast on‑site channel status checking,supports hot‑swap replacement during equipment maintenance

Product Brief
X20AT4222 belongs to B&R X20 I/O module family,it is four‑channel RTD temperature spare part,different from 2‑channel X20AT2222 module. Bus module and terminal block need to be ordered separately for field wiring. Widely used for original B&R automation equipment maintenance and renovation.
